Why we recommend this

Its f/4 maximum aperture and inclusion of three UD and three aspherical elements deliver sharp, corrected images across its versatile 14-35mm zoom range. The lens is built for the Canon RF system, offering full-frame coverage with built-in image stabilization for handheld shooting. This lens is best for Canon photographers who need a compact, high-performance ultra-wide zoom for landscapes and architectural work where edge-to-edge sharpness is critical.

Why we recommend this

Its constant f/4 aperture and built-in Optical Image Stabilizer provide reliable performance for handheld shooting in varied lighting. The lens features a robust L-series build with a fluorine coating for durability and easier cleaning. This lens is best for landscape photographers and videographers who need a sharp, stabilized wide-angle zoom for environmental shots and cinematic b-roll.
